An eclectic afternoon of music by composer-performers that blurs the boundaries between classical, electronic and other genres, featuring improvisation, song, samples and more.

The concert includes Hoda Jahanpour’s explorations of memory and the natural world, abstract-vocalism from Michael Howell, sonic journeys that blend classical, jazz and electronic music with Rebekah Reid and Zara Antonia’s immersive music that combines lyrics, samples and electronics. 

The weekend’s two recitals are a result of a collaboration between Black Lives in Music and Britten Pears Arts, showcasing standout artists selected through a national open call, with the selected artists presenting two vibrant and diverse programmes to demonstrate their artistry.
